To arrange a DOT drug or alcohol test in Pittsfield, MA, contact us at (800) 221-4291 or utilize our online system by selecting your test and completing the registration section. Registration is necessary before visiting a testing center.
The zip code you provide helps identify the nearest testing center in Pittsfield, Massachusetts. A donor pass with center details will be emailed to you; present this form at the center. Generally, appointments aren't needed, but complete the donor section and make payment upon registering.
Our laboratories are SAMHSA-certified with results verified by Medical Review Officers (MRO), ensuring reliable outcomes.

Marijuana-Related Accidents in Pittsfield, MA
Since the legalization of marijuana in Massachusetts, including Pittsfield and the surrounding Berkshire County, monitoring marijuana-related vehicular incidents has become a DOT priority. In Pittsfield, the impact of marijuana on driving safety is assessed through a combination of data collection, public education, and enforcement strategies. The Massachusetts DOT collaborates with local authorities to track trends in marijuana-related accidents, aiming to understand their prevalence and effects. Awareness campaigns are underway to educate drivers about the potential impairments caused by marijuana consumption. These efforts include highlighting the legal repercussions and promoting safer alternatives. While legalization has led to more open discussions about marijuana use, the DOT’s focus remains firmly on reducing any adverse impacts on road safety, working diligently towards a decrease in marijuana-involved accidents.
